What does a Software Consultant do?

A Software Consultant advises clients on software solutions to meet their business needs, often customizing and integrating applications. Their daily workflow includes analyzing requirements, recommending technologies, and collaborating with developers and stakeholders. They typically work in office environments or remotely, using tools such as project management software, development platforms, and communication tools.

What are some responsibilities of a Software Consultant?

A Software Consultant assesses client systems and recommends product improvements or new software solutions. They manage project timelines, solve technical challenges, and ensure software aligns with business goals. They also facilitate communication between technical teams and clients to ensure successful implementation and adoption.

Common Mistakes to Avoid When Writing a Software Consultant Resume

Common mistakes include listing outdated technologies, using vague job descriptions, neglecting to showcase measurable accomplishments, failing to tailor the resume to specific job requirements, and omitting relevant certifications.

Key Takeaways for a Software Consultant Resume

A strong Software Consultant resume clearly highlights relevant experience and technical skills, showcases measurable results, and aligns closely with the job description. It balances technical expertise with communication and consulting abilities to demonstrate well-rounded qualifications.

  • Highlight hands-on experience relevant to the Software Consultant role.
  • Use measurable results to demonstrate achievements and impact.
  • Add relevant certifications or completed courses related to Software Consultant.
  • Tailor each resume to the specific job posting.
  • Balance technical expertise with communication and teamwork skills.
